i don't feel is slow for me, but if something slow there are many other issue will cause it. You may try to check:
1. RAM speed & size
2. HDD speed and free space
3. Processor speed
4. Program that run concurrently on that machine or server
5. The LAN/WAN speed
There still be more other will affect, but all is just my personal suggestion

Sugar, in and of itself, is definitely not a slow running software. It takes very little resources on a standard server. The speed of the response time is related to any number of external reasons.
First, I suggest you find out where you sugar is hosted. It could be on a Sugar server but it could be at your location or at a remote location.
Once you know where it is you may be able to identify the problem. It could be, as mentioned above, the equipment. It could be the amount of data stored on the server. It could be simply that a loop of some sort is slowing your server. Sometimes a simple apache restart can fix the problem, if you are running on a LAMP stack. And, it could simply be your own internet connectivity.
Those are some areas to look into to correct your issue.
